{"id":49402,"date":"2020-04-27T12:00:00","date_gmt":"2020-04-27T11:00:00","guid":{"rendered":"https:\/\/churchtools.academy\/changelog\/web-v3-58-0\/"},"modified":"2020-04-27T12:00:00","modified_gmt":"2020-04-27T11:00:00","slug":"web-v3-58-0","status":"publish","type":"changelog","link":"https:\/\/churchtools.academy\/de\/changelog\/web-v3-58-0\/","title":{"rendered":"Web v3.58.0"},"content":{"rendered":"\n<p><strong>Verbesserungen<\/strong><\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Personen &amp; Gruppen<\/strong>\n<ul class=\"wp-block-list\">\n<li>Das L\u00f6schen von Personen wurde verbessert. Die Geschwindigkeit war in der letzten Version etwas langsam geworden.<\/li>\n\n\n\n<li>Das gruppeninterne Recht &#8222;Darf Gruppen erstellen&#8220; erm\u00f6glicht nun auch das Kopieren von Gruppen (beschr\u00e4nkt auf Untergruppen der Gruppe f\u00fcr die das Recht vergeben wurde).<\/li>\n\n\n\n<li>Bei Anmeldungen \u00fcber die Gruppenhomepage ist es nun m\u00f6glich, einen Ehepartner oder Kinder unter 16 Jahren anzumelden, selbst wenn die Personen noch nicht in ChurchTools registriert sind. Vorher war die Anmeldung von Familienmitgliedern nur m\u00f6glich, wenn diese bereits in ChurchTools registriert waren.<\/li>\n\n\n\n<li>Auf der Gruppendetailseite der Gruppenhomepage gibt es nun einen Zur\u00fcck-Button.<\/li>\n\n\n\n<li>Die Einstellungen f\u00fcr die Gruppenhomepage wurden \u00fcberarbeitet, sodass man nun im gleichen Fenster eine Ansicht dergleichen hat.<\/li>\n<\/ul>\n<\/li>\n\n\n\n<li><strong>Finanzen<\/strong>\n<ul class=\"wp-block-list\">\n<li>Im Buchungsjournal ist es nun m\u00f6glich, mehrere Buchungen in einem Schritt festzuschreiben.<\/li>\n\n\n\n<li>Es gibt jetzt eine Spender\u00fcbersicht, als Vorbereitung f\u00fcr die Spenenbescheinigung.<\/li>\n<\/ul>\n<\/li>\n\n\n\n<li><strong>Kalender<\/strong>\n<ul class=\"wp-block-list\">\n<li>Es gibt nun einen visuellen Editor f\u00fcr das Erstellen eines eingebetteten Kalenders.<\/li>\n<\/ul>\n<\/li>\n\n\n\n<li><strong>Reports<\/strong>\n<ul class=\"wp-block-list\">\n<li>Es gibt einen neuen AdHoc-Report f\u00fcr die App-Nutzung.<\/li>\n\n\n\n<li>Bezeichnungen einer AdHoc-Abfrage werden jetzt auch \u00fcbersetzt angezeigt, wenn es eine \u00dcbersetzung gibt.<\/li>\n<\/ul>\n<\/li>\n\n\n\n<li><strong>REST-API<\/strong>\n<ul class=\"wp-block-list\">\n<li>Neuer Endpoint f\u00fcr Batch Commands: PATCH \/finance\/transactions<\/li>\n<\/ul>\n<\/li>\n<\/ul>\n\n\n\n<p><strong>Behobene Fehler<\/strong><\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Allgemein<\/strong>\n<ul class=\"wp-block-list\">\n<li>In Tabellen wird das Offset nun wieder zur\u00fcckgesetzt, wenn die maximale Anzeige von Zeilen ge\u00e4ndert wird.<\/li>\n\n\n\n<li>In der Standard-Tabelle wurden die Links f\u00fcr die Paginierung angepasst und verbessert.<\/li>\n\n\n\n<li>In der Geburtstagsliste wird das Alter nur bei einer validen Jahreszahl ausgegeben.<\/li>\n<\/ul>\n<\/li>\n\n\n\n<li><strong>Personen &amp; Gruppen<\/strong>\n<ul class=\"wp-block-list\">\n<li>Der Link &#8222;Gruppenhomepage bearbeiten&#8220; in einer Gruppe wird jetzt angezeigt, wenn sich min. eine \u00f6ffentliche Gruppe in der Hierachie dieser Gruppe befindet.<\/li>\n\n\n\n<li>Die Reihenfolge der Datenfelder in der Anfragemail an den Leiter einer \u00f6ffentlichen Gruppe wurde korrigiert.<\/li>\n\n\n\n<li>Es ist nun nicht mehr m\u00f6glich, einen Serienbrief ohne Empf\u00e4nger zu erstellen.<\/li>\n\n\n\n<li>Die Datenschutz-Erkl\u00e4rung wird im Embedded-View der Gruppenhomepage nun in einem neuen Tab ge\u00f6ffnet.<\/li>\n\n\n\n<li>In der Gruppenbeschreibung wird einfaches HTML nun wieder richtig dargestellt.<\/li>\n\n\n\n<li>Der Tag-Select von Gruppen wird nicht mehr vom Copyright der OSM \u00fcberdeckt.<\/li>\n\n\n\n<li>Der Standardwert f\u00fcr Checkboxen wird nun im Anmeldeformular f\u00fcr Gruppen richtig gesetzt (1 = true, alles andere false)<\/li>\n\n\n\n<li>Beim Neuanlegen von Personen werden nur noch relevante zus\u00e4tzliche Felder angezeigt.<\/li>\n\n\n\n<li>In der Gruppenteilnehmer-Liste wird jetzt auch f\u00fcr Selects der &#8222;title&#8220; gesetzt, sodass abgeschnittene Inhalte lesbar bleiben.<\/li>\n\n\n\n<li>Ein DB-Feld des Typs Ja-Nein wird jetzt auch als solches gerendert und nicht mehr als 0 und 1.<\/li>\n\n\n\n<li>In den Filter-Selects werden nun die Sortkeys f\u00fcr Stationen und Status beachtet.<\/li>\n\n\n\n<li>Das L\u00f6schen von Personen im Archiv ist jetzt wieder m\u00f6glich auch wenn diese noch in Gruppen sind.<\/li>\n\n\n\n<li>Auf der alten Gruppenhomepage funktionieren jetzt auch Auswahlfelder f\u00fcr das Geschlecht, die keine Pflichtfelder sind.<\/li>\n\n\n\n<li>Bei der Anmeldung zu \u00f6ffentlichen Gruppen verhalten sich Auswahlfelder, die keine Pflichtfelder sind, jetzt korrekt, wenn keine Eingabe gemacht wurde.<\/li>\n\n\n\n<li>Der Pfad zur URL einer \u00f6ffentlichen Gruppe l\u00e4sst sich nun auch optional mit einem &#8222;\/&#8220; abschlie\u00dfen.<\/li>\n<\/ul>\n<\/li>\n\n\n\n<li><strong>Kalender<\/strong>\n<ul class=\"wp-block-list\">\n<li>F\u00fcr den \u00f6ffentlichen User werden wieder alle Kalender default-m\u00e4\u00dfig ausgew\u00e4hlt.<\/li>\n\n\n\n<li>In den Einstellungen f\u00fcr einen Kalender ist es wieder m\u00f6glich eine Station und ein Template zu l\u00f6schen.<\/li>\n<\/ul>\n<\/li>\n\n\n\n<li><strong>Events<\/strong>\n<ul class=\"wp-block-list\">\n<li>Wenn man die Seite der Stammdaten neu geladen hat, konnte man keine neuen Dienste mehr hinzuf\u00fcgen. Das wurde nun behoben.<\/li>\n\n\n\n<li>Gruppen werden in der Dienstauswahl jetzt alphabetisch sortiert.<\/li>\n\n\n\n<li>Wenn man eine Dienstanfrage oder -zusage mit Enter absagt, wird dies nun gespeichert und die Events werden aktualisiert.<\/li>\n\n\n\n<li>Der kombinierte Filter von &#8218;Dienstgruppe&#8216; und &#8218;Meine Filter&#8216; funktioniert wieder als UND-Verkn\u00fcpfung.<\/li>\n\n\n\n<li>Wenn bei aktiviertem Filter ein Event verschwindet, weil es nicht mehr den Kriterien entspricht, verschwindet nun auch die \u00dcberschrift, wenn es das einzige Element war.<\/li>\n<\/ul>\n<\/li>\n\n\n\n<li><strong>Checkin<\/strong>\n<ul class=\"wp-block-list\">\n<li>Wenn eine neue Person zur Gruppe hinzugef\u00fcgt wird, bleibt die ausgew\u00e4hlte Gruppe weiter bestehen. Vorher wurde eine andere Gruppe ausgew\u00e4hlt.<\/li>\n<\/ul>\n<\/li>\n\n\n\n<li><strong>Wiki<\/strong>\n<ul class=\"wp-block-list\">\n<li>Das Scrollen zu den \u00dcberschriften funktioniert nun wieder in allen Browsern.<\/li>\n<\/ul>\n<\/li>\n\n\n\n<li><strong>Finanzen<\/strong>\n<ul class=\"wp-block-list\">\n<li>Buchungsjahre kann man nun auch im Safari neu anlegen.<\/li>\n<\/ul>\n<\/li>\n<\/ul>\n\n\n\n<p><strong>Sicherheitsbehebung<\/strong><\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Allgemein<\/strong>\n<ul class=\"wp-block-list\">\n<li>Behebt unerlaubtes Auslesen des Login Tokens.<\/li>\n\n\n\n<li>Der LDAP-Service pr\u00fcft jetzt bei der Authentifizierung von Benutzern, ob die Zwei-Faktor-Authentifizierung aktiviert ist. Ist das der Fall, muss der Benutzer beim Login in das externe System an sein Passwort das generierte Token anh\u00e4ngen. Dieses Verhalten des LDAP-Service kann in den Admin-Einstellungen deaktiviert werden.<\/li>\n<\/ul>\n<\/li>\n<\/ul>\n","protected":false},"template":"","plattform":[687],"class_list":["post-49402","changelog","type-changelog","status-publish","hentry","plattform-web"],"pp_statuses_selecting_workflow":false,"pp_workflow_action":"current","pp_status_selection":"publish","acf":{"version":"3.58.0"},"_links":{"self":[{"href":"https:\/\/churchtools.academy\/de\/wp-json\/wp\/v2\/changelog\/49402","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/churchtools.academy\/de\/wp-json\/wp\/v2\/changelog"}],"about":[{"href":"https:\/\/churchtools.academy\/de\/wp-json\/wp\/v2\/types\/changelog"}],"version-history":[{"count":0,"href":"https:\/\/churchtools.academy\/de\/wp-json\/wp\/v2\/changelog\/49402\/revisions"}],"wp:attachment":[{"href":"https:\/\/churchtools.academy\/de\/wp-json\/wp\/v2\/media?parent=49402"}],"wp:term":[{"taxonomy":"plattform","embeddable":true,"href":"https:\/\/churchtools.academy\/de\/wp-json\/wp\/v2\/plattform?post=49402"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}